Annie Louise Vachule (Speegle)
Annie Louise Vachule, 92, born February 8, 1923, in Hartselle, AL passed away January 16, 2016, in Kemah, TX.
She is survived by her children, Carol Guillot and husband David, Linda Willard and husband David, Nancy Vachule and husband Glen Gordy, Joe Vachule and wife Cathy; by her sister, Martha Ann Couey; by her grandchildren, Kelly Grant, Robert Kelly, Hannah Vachule, Liesa Gray, Tracy Greer, April Supak, also by many great-grandchildren, nieces, nephews, and friends.
She was preceded in death by her husband, Joe Vachule; by her mother and father, Charly and Cary Mae Speegle; by her sister, Nellie Smith; by her brothers, Ralph Speegle and Erskin Speegle.
Annie Louise loved fishing, soap operas, quilting, crocheting, sports, and her many beloved pets.
She worked for Northrup Grumman on components for the NASA Space Program, and on the First Lunar Landing in 1969 which gave her a great sense of pride.
Her life was her own invention. We will miss her dearly and think of her often with love and fond memories (and a few giggles).
